Output d66d3c39f76d7f4cd3671b61ba15c0b173d15ff71fca127fedf6b91abe4232f5:0

value
1069762
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2feae98878d0e34ac3dc2a2adeda1eab03b22aac OP_EQUALVERIFY OP_CHECKSIG
address
15NNB1GBr23rLVZTUBEDC888EvuHCSifYg
transaction
d66d3c39f76d7f4cd3671b61ba15c0b173d15ff71fca127fedf6b91abe4232f5
confirmations
9049
spent
true